Wilmington P.D.’s overnight crime report

Wilmington Police Department (NEWS RELEASE)
Overnight Report
September 1 – 2, 2010

Case#: 2010-031632
Time: 2:59 p.m. – Wednesday
Location: 341 S. College Rd. – Dollar Tree parking lot
Summary: The female victim reported that she was placing her items in her car when a woman approached and grabbed her purse. The victim said she struggled with the woman who then assaulted her with a shopping cart. Then the woman ran and jumped into a black SUV. WPD officers were able to intercept the SUV and stop it in the 5200 block of Market Street. The driver and passenger were detained for questioning. Michelle Dawn Webb, d.o.b. 12-27-1969, of Wilmington, and James Douglas Boney, d.o.b. 11-28-1969, of Rocky Point , were arrested and charged with Common Law Robbery. They are in custody at the New Hanover County detention facility under $50,000 bond each.

Case#: 2010-0316392
Time: 10:28 p.m. – Wednesday
Location: 1605 South 11th Street
Offense: ADW (domestic)
Summary: The male victim, age 51, told officers that he had been arguing with his girlfriend when she stabbed him in the upper arm. The woman he identified, Kimberly (no middle name) Moore, d.o.b. 1-1-1974, was arrested and charged with Assault with a Deadly Weapon. She is being held without bond at the New Hanover County detention facility. Her photo is attached.

Case#:2010-031694
Time: 10:42 p.m. – Wednesday
Location: 717 Dawson Street
Offense: ADWIKISI
Summary: Officers responded to NHRMC emergency room to speak with a man who had been driven to the hospital by a private citizen. The victim said that he had been playing pool at a game room on Dawson Street. He said he went to his car parked in front of the building to get some money. He said he was sitting in the car reaching into the glove compartment to get money when a man rode up on a bicycle and fired two shots, hitting him in the arm and the leg. Then the shooter rode away. The victim said he did not get a good look at the man who shot him.
